Advertisement

永中Yozo签名Java SDK

  •  5星
  •     浏览量: 0
  •     大小:None
  •      文件类型:None


简介:
永中Yozo签名Java SDK是一款专为开发者设计的软件开发工具包,支持在Java应用程序中实现文档签名与验证功能,确保数据安全及完整性。 yozo永中签名JavaSDK是一款软件开发工具包,旨在帮助开发者在使用永中产品的项目中实现电子签名功能。此SDK为开发者提供了便捷的接口来集成电子签名服务,简化了应用开发流程,并提升了用户体验。通过利用该SDK,用户可以更加高效地完成相关业务操作,满足多样化的应用场景需求。

全部评论 (0)

还没有任何评论哟~
客服
客服
  • YozoJava SDK
    优质
    永中Yozo签名Java SDK是一款专为开发者设计的软件开发工具包,支持在Java应用程序中实现文档签名与验证功能,确保数据安全及完整性。 yozo永中签名JavaSDK是一款软件开发工具包,旨在帮助开发者在使用永中产品的项目中实现电子签名功能。此SDK为开发者提供了便捷的接口来集成电子签名服务,简化了应用开发流程,并提升了用户体验。通过利用该SDK,用户可以更加高效地完成相关业务操作,满足多样化的应用场景需求。
  • C#验证,Java生成
    优质
    本文档介绍了如何使用C#语言验证数字签名以及利用Java技术生成数字签名的方法和步骤。通过具体示例帮助开发者理解和实现安全的数据交换机制。 对Java签名数据进行验签可以直接使用。代码中有详细的注释。
  • 微软Windows SDK的Signtool.exe数字工具
    优质
    简介:Signtool.exe是微软Windows SDK提供的一个命令行工具,用于对可执行文件、库和脚本等进行代码签名,确保软件来源可信及完整性。 1. 使用ClickOnce发布应用时提示缺少Signtool.exe,在压缩包内提供了一个6.1.7600.16385版本的文件,已在VS2015、Win10环境下验证通过。 2. 将该文件复制到C:\Program Files (x86)\Microsoft SDKs\Windows\v7.0A\Bin目录下。
  • JAVA的国密SM2及验算法
    优质
    本文介绍了在Java环境下实现中国国产密码标准(GM/T 0021-2012)中定义的SM2椭圆曲线公钥加密算法的具体步骤,包括详细的SM2签名与验证过程。 功能:签名与验签已封装完成,并经过测试有效,可直接使用。
  • JavaRSA数字的实现
    优质
    本篇文章深入探讨了在Java环境中如何具体实施RSA算法进行数据加密与安全传输,并详细介绍了利用RSA算法实现数字签名的具体步骤。 数字签名原理使用RSA算法进行数字签名的过程可以概括为:发送者利用私钥参数d对消息进行加密(即生成签名),接收方则通过发送者的公钥参数e来解密并验证信息的合法性。 具体步骤如下: 1. **密钥生成**: 用户随机产生一对密钥,包括一个公钥(e,n)和一个私钥(d,n). 2. **签名过程**: a) 计算消息M的散列值H(M). b) 使用私钥(d,n),对上述计算得到的散列值进行加密处理:s=(H(M))^d mod n,其中结果s即为数字签名。 c) 将原信息和生成的签名一并发送给接收方(即消息M与签名s)。 3. **验证过程**: a) 接收者获取发信者的公钥(e,n). b) 利用该公钥,对接收到的消息中的数字签名进行解密处理:h=s^e mod n. c) 计算接收到消息的散列值H(M). d) 比较两个结果,如果两者相等(即h=H(M),则说明发信者的签名是有效的;反之,则为无效。 根据上述过程可以绘制出RSA数字签名的工作流程图。假设Alice想要与Bob通信,可以通过以下步骤模拟: 1. **密钥生成**:Alice使用RSA算法生成一对公钥(e,n)和私钥(d,n), 并分别保存在pubKey.txt和priKey.txt文件中。 2. **分发公钥**:将包含公钥的pubKey.txt从Alice发送给Bob,模拟公玥(即公开密钥)的分发过程。 3. **消息散列处理**:使用信息文件info.txt生成哈希值,并将其保存到hashInfo.txt中。 4. **签名与传递**:将带有数字签名的消息和相关散列表现形式从Alice发送至Bob,模拟实际通信环境中的密文状态下的签名传输过程。 5. **验证接收消息的合法性**: Bob获取公钥pubKey.txt,并使用此公玥解密收到的签名。同时计算接收到信息的哈希值H(M)并比较两者是否一致。如果h=H(M),则表示数字签名有效;否则,表示无效。 以上就是通过模拟文件夹Alice和Bob进行RSA算法中消息M及签名分发与验证的基本过程描述及其应用示例说明。
  • JavaDSA算法的实现
    优质
    本文章介绍了如何在Java编程语言环境中具体实施数字签名算法(DSA),为开发者提供详细的操作指南和代码示例。 Jeffrey Walton 在 StackOverflow 上发布了一篇文章,介绍了如何用 Java 实现 DSA 数字签名算法,包括生成签名、消息签名和验证签名三个功能的实现。
  • JavaRSA数字的实现
    优质
    本文章主要介绍在Java编程环境下如何使用RSA算法实现数据的安全签名和验证过程,确保数据完整性和不可抵赖性。 该源码分为两个包:一个rsa包和一个utils包。使用了面向对象的思想,将公用的方法放到了utils包中。 在rsa包中有以下文件: - GenerateKeyPair.java:用于生成密钥对。 - SignatureData.java:实现数字签名功能。 - VerifySignature.java:实现数字签名验证,并包含主程序(main函数)。 在utils包中有一个工具类BitByte.java,该类实现了二进制流和十六进制流之间的转换。
  • Java海关179
    优质
    Java海关签名179可能是指使用Java编程语言进行海关相关业务(如报关、清关等)中的数字签名技术实现。该主题涉及如何利用Java开发安全可靠的海关电子签名系统,确保交易数据的完整性和不可否认性。 Java海关179签名涉及使用Java语言进行特定的海关相关操作或数据处理,并采用179算法或其他指定方法生成签名以确保数据安全性和完整性。
  • Java PDF章示例代码
    优质
    本项目提供了一系列用Java语言编写的PDF签名和签章示例代码,旨在帮助开发者轻松实现文档的安全性和可信度增强功能。 使用Java的itext库可以对PDF文档进行签名签章操作。这包括:创建新的PDF文档、在PDF上添加水印(文本形式)、将图片作为水印加入到PDF中,以及为PDF文件生成数字签名。此外,还可以通过读取P12密钥库中的证书来加密和签署PDF文档。
  • Java源码-ApkSignatureKiller:一键绕过APK校验
    优质
    ApkSignatureKiller是一款用于绕过Android APK文件签名校验的一键式工具,基于Java签名源码开发,旨在帮助开发者便捷地测试和修改未授权的APK程序。但请注意,此工具仅限于合法的软件调试与研究目的使用,请勿将其应用于非法操作或侵犯版权的行为中。 Java签名源码 该工具基于现有的技术进行改进,并完全使用纯Java语言实现。 **原理** 通过在Application入口处插入代码,hook了程序中的PackageManager的getPackageInfo方法,从而改变了获取到的签名信息。 **处理步骤** 1. 读取原APK的签名信息。 2. 替换或添加AndroidManifest.xml中application的name属性。 3. 修改PmsHookApplication.smali文件,并替换其中的签名信息。如果原始APK自定义了Application类,还需要修改PmsHookApplication的父类。最后编译smali代码并将其加入到classes.dex文件中。 4. 对生成的新APK进行重新签名。 **使用方法** 1. 安装Java环境。 2. 修改config.txt中的配置信息,并将需要处理的apk放置在项目根目录下。 3. 运行工具,有三种方式: - 使用IDEA打开项目并运行源码; - 在Windows系统中直接执行run.bat文件; - 对于Linux或MacOS用户,在终端里执行相应命令。